SAN FRANCISCO (October 29, 2018)  – The upcoming single fromKarla Kane, “Goodguy Sun,” paints a wistful classic-pop picture that encapsulates the feelings of summer giving way to autumn. Written by DIY pop master Martin Newell (Cleaners From Venus), it’s a mix of California sunshine and English melancholy, as befitting its transatlantic origins. The song is being released in conjunction with the autumn issue of Big Stir Magazine (in which Kane interviews both Newell and Robyn Hitchcock) and its monthly Burbank concert series. Sweden (October 29, 2018) – Swedish pop-punk rockers Frankley Everlongwill release their upcoming sophomore full-length album entitled Till the Dance Do Us Part on January 18, 2019 via Eclipse Records. The album was produced by Tommy Carlsson at They Pop You Late Studios. The album art was designed by Pernilla Hedin. Montreal-based artist Sara Diamond has released her anticipated debut EP, Foreword. The EP is about crossing the barrier of fear into the unknown and includes four of her previously released singles in addition to three new tracks. Sara has spent the past year releasing music about the ups and downs of love. Those songs have amassed over 13 million plays and landed her in the Spotify Viral Top 50 Chart.
